Spicy Sesame Stir Fry
This delicious, flavorful, and spicy stir fry is great when you want a quick weeknight meal. You can eat this on it's own, or enjoy this as a filling for lettuce wraps.
Ingredients
- 1 Tbsp1 Tbsp1 Tbsp Original Extra Virgin Olive Oil - Kosterina
- 1 cup1 cup1 cup Savoy Cabbage, chopped
- 1/2 cup1/2 cup1/2 cup Onion, diced
- 1/2 cup1/2 cup1/2 cup White Mushrooms, Raw, sliced
- 1 lb1 lb1 lb Ground Chicken
- 1 tsp1 tsp1 tsp Citrus Stir Fry Seasoning - Primal Palate
- 2 tsp2 tsp2 tsp Barrel Aged Tamari Soy Sauce - Jozo
- 2 Tbsp2 Tbsp2 Tbsp Coconut Aminos
- 1 Tbsp1 Tbsp1 Tbsp Toasted Sesame Oil
- 1 1/2 cups1 1/2 cups1 1/2 cups Cauliflower, grated
- 1 tsp1 tsp1 tsp Hot Crispy Oil, Original - Hot Crispy Oil
- 1/4 cup1/4 cup1/4 cup Green Onion (Scallion), chopped thin
- 1/4 cup1/4 cup1/4 cup Peanuts, chopped

- Heat the olive oil in a saute pan.
- Add the cabbage, onion and mushrooms to the saute pan, and cook over medium heat for 5 minutes. Stir frequently.
- Add the ground chicken to the pan, and break up the meat into small pieces with a spatula as you brown it. Cook it along with the veggies while stirring until the chicken is fully browned.
- Season the ground chicken and veggies with the Citrus Stir Fry Seasoning.
- Drizzle the Jozo tamari over the mixture, along with the coconut aminos, and toasted sesame oil. Stir to combine.
- Stir in the grated cauliflower, and allow to cook for 5 minutes. Stir often.
- Drizzle the hot crispy oil over the stir fry, and stir to combine.
- Mix in the chopped scallion and peanuts, and serve on it's own, or with lettuce wraps.
